In 2020, budding engineers Utkarsh Singh and Vikrant Singh were attempting to build an electric vehicle for a college project when they hit a massive roadblock: India simply didn&#8217;t have enough lithium-ion cells.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Realizing that the future of clean mobility would be paralyzed without a secure, domestic supply of raw materials, the duo pivoted. Instead of building cars, they decided to mine the batteries that power them\u2014not from the earth, but from end-of-life battery packs. Today, BatX Energies stands at the forefront of India&#8217;s circular economy, transforming discarded tech into battery-grade materials.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Cracking the Code: A Zero-Waste, High-Yield Technology<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Traditional battery recycling often relies on highly polluting pyrometallurgical methods\u2014essentially smelting the batteries down. BatX Energies takes a different, greener approach, relying on a proprietary, water-based hydrometallurgical process. This ensures that their operations remain environmentally sustainable while maximizing resource efficiency.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Here is what makes their technological process a game-changer for the industry: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Unmatched Recovery Rates:<\/strong> The startup achieves an impressive 97\u201399% recovery rate of essential metals like lithium, cobalt, nickel, and manganese.<\/li>\n\n\n\n<li><strong>Battery-Grade Purity:<\/strong> The extracted critical minerals boast a 99.5%+ purity level, making them immediately viable for new cathode and cell manufacturing.<\/li>\n\n\n\n<li><strong>Traceable Supply Chain:<\/strong> Every tonne of battery waste is tracked across a rigorous 7-stage processing line, offering full chain-of-custody documentation to enterprise partners and OEMs.<\/li>\n\n\n\n<li><strong>Commercial Scale Operations:<\/strong> With a processing capacity of 5,100 metric tonnes annually at their Hub-1 facility, BatX is already operating at a massive industrial scale.<\/li>\n<\/ul>\n\n\n\n<p class=\"wp-block-paragraph\">Furthermore, the recycling process also yields secondary products like high-grade plastic, aluminum, copper, and stainless steel, ensuring a zero-waste loop. Batteries that still have remaining capacity are thoroughly assessed and repurposed into second-life batteries for stationary energy storage before they are ever sent to the recycling line.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">The \u20b9105 Crore Bet on India&#8217;s Energy Independence<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">In July 2026, the financial and tech industries took serious notice. BatX Energies secured a massive \u20b9105 crore (approx. $12.5 million) in a Series A funding round led by IvyCap Ventures. The round also saw heavy participation from existing backers, including Zephyr Peacock, Mankind Pharma Family Office, Excel Industries Family Office, and JITO.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Vikram Gupta, Founder and Managing Partner at IvyCap Ventures, summed up the investment rationale perfectly: <em>&#8220;India&#8217;s energy transition depends on securing sustainable access to critical minerals. BatX has built a strong technology-led platform&#8230; addressing a challenge of both economic and strategic importance&#8221;.<\/em><\/p>\n\n\n\n<p class=\"wp-block-paragraph\">With this fresh capital infusion, the founders plan to expand their refining capacity, double down on research and development for cathode active materials (CAM), and ultimately scale their homegrown technology to global markets. As co-founder Utkarsh Singh noted, securing domestic supplies of critical minerals is a global challenge, and BatX is positioned to enable resilient supply chains worldwide.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Why Battery Recycling is India&#8217;s Strategic Imperative<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">As India aggressively scales electric mobility and renewable energy grids, the demand for strategic minerals is skyrocketing. Currently, India imports the vast majority of its battery raw materials, leading to severe supply-chain vulnerabilities and massive foreign exchange outflows.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Lithium-ion battery recycling in India is no longer just an environmental initiative; it is a matter of national energy security. By reclaiming these critical minerals domestically, BatX Energies helps manufacturers reduce their dependence on volatile global supply chains and resource-intensive mining.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Additionally, the company actively assists producers, importers, and brand owners in meeting their regulatory obligations under India&#8217;s Extended Producer Responsibility (EPR) framework, ensuring that corporate compliance matches environmental stewardship. This aligns directly with the country&#8217;s <em>Atmanirbhar Bharat<\/em> (Self-Reliant India) and Net Zero 2070 goals.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">The Bottom Line: A Circular Future<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">BatX Energies proves that the transition to green energy doesn&#8217;t have to rely on dirty mining.
